Italian brigade and ingredients imported from Italy

The difference shows in the kitchen. Our brigade is made of Italian chefs, and cooking within the original food culture matters: the gestures, the rest times, the cooking thresholds, all of it follows from that habit. We do not translate a recipe, we execute it the way it is done at home.

The base ingredients follow the same logic. Italian flour for the pizza, olive oil, cured meats and cheese from Italy. It is not a marketing line: it is what allows the dough to carry the right hydration, the mascarpone to hold up on the tiramisu, the cheese to melt without sourness. Without those products, the recipe falls flat even when well executed.

A few markers rarely lie: a genuinely Italian brigade, fresh pasta rolled on site every day rather than bought ready-made, and core ingredients imported from Italy (San Marzano DOP tomatoes from Campania, olive oil from Puglia, Parmigiano Reggiano PDO). A full menu that is not limited to pizza, sauces built to order and desserts plated in the kitchen are further signs of a real handmade kitchen. At Pepe Zino, in Aubagne, this is exactly the stance we claim, with no vacuum-packed dishes and no industrial menu.
Because a recipe rests as much on the product as on the gesture. A San Marzano DOP tomato gives a real sauce its sugar-acidity balance; Parmigiano Reggiano PDO melts and seasons without bitterness; olive oil from Puglia and Italian flour give the dough its texture and taste. With substitute ingredients, the same well-executed recipe falls flat. At Pepe Zino, these core products come from Italy, like the Italian brigade that works them.
